Mayer Brown appoints counsel from Treasury

Mayer Brown, the law firm, has appointed Alexandria Carr to its financial services, regulatory and enforcement group in London as Of Counsel. Carr is a barrister and is the lead legal adviser at HM Treasury on EU financial services strategy. Carr will spend much of her time seconded to HM Treasury through August as legal advisor to a team considering eurozone developments, including an EU banking union.
